Brief summary

A single centre, placebo controlled, blinded (participant, investigator, outcome assessor) trial to evaluate the effects of COX-2 inhibition with celecoxib on endothelial function in healthy male volunteers.

Detailed description

Primary Objective: To perform a systemic analysis of how COX-2 inhibition by celecoxib affects vascular function and 'omic biomarkers including those associated with the COX-2/prostacyclin/ADMA axis in healthy male volunteers Secondary Objective: To investigate how this is altered by L-arginine supplementation Methods: A single centre, double blind, placebo controlled trial will be carried out in healthy male volunteers between 18 and 40 years of age. In phase 1, participants will be blinded and randomised to receive either Celecoxib 200mgBD for 7 days or placebo. The primary endpoint is endothelial function measured by EndoPAT. In Phase 2, the same participants will receive either Celecoxib 200mgBD for 7 days + 10g L-arginine supplementation or placebo + 10g L-arginine supplementation to see if L-arginine can reverse any endothelial dysfunction caused by Celecoxib. Secondary outcomes will include measurement of 'omic biomarkers.

Inclusion criteria

* No abnormal findings on medical history, screening physical examination, hematology, biochemistry, urinalysis (including specific gravity), and vital signs (sitting blood pressure, sitting pulse rate, sitting respiratory rate and body temperature) within 2 weeks of commencement of the study. * Normal fasting lipid profile * Non-smoking * Clear venous access in upper limbs * BMI: 18-30 * No history or signs of drug abuse * No other medication 4 weeks before or during the study * Informed written consent

Exclusion criteria

* Any history of allergy to NSAIDS or arginine * Significant medical conditions * Pulse rate \<50 bpm * Sitting systolic blood pressure \<80 or \>160 mmHg * Sitting diastolic pressure \<60 or \>100 mmHg * Baseline endothelial dysfunction (as defined by EndoPAT; LnRHI \<0.51) * Participation in other clinical study 8 weeks before or during the study * Donation of blood 8 weeks before or during the study * Those on medication that cannot be discontinued

Outcome results

Primary

Augmentation Index

Measured using the EndoPAT 2000 device (which is an FDA approved medical device) at baseline and at 7 days. Data are issued by the equipment. Augmentation index (which is a surrogate for vascular stiffness). An increase indicates an increase in vascular stiffness.

Time frame: Baseline and 7 days

ArmMeasureValue (MEAN)Dispersion
CelecoxibAugmentation Index3.7 Augmentation IndexStandard Deviation 9.05
PlaceboAugmentation Index-2.54 Augmentation IndexStandard Deviation 10.24
Primary

Log Reactive Hyperaemic Index

Measured using the EndoPAT 2000 device (which is an FDA approved medical device). Data are issued by the equipment as: LnRHI (Log Reactive hyperaemic index), a reduction from the individual participant baseline value indicates endothelial dysfunction

Time frame: Baseline and 7 days

Population: Data presented as mean change from baseline (delta)

ArmMeasureValue (MEAN)Dispersion
CelecoxibLog Reactive Hyperaemic Index0.003 LnRHI (Log Reactive hyperaemic index)Standard Deviation 0.35
PlaceboLog Reactive Hyperaemic Index0.095 LnRHI (Log Reactive hyperaemic index)Standard Deviation 0.33
